PROCEDURE
实验过程
20 mg (0.08 mmol) of diflunisal, 14 mg (0.093 mmol) of NaI and 30 mg (0.13 mmol) of CAT dissolved in 1040 μl of acetonitrile and 52 μl of acetic acid are placed in a 25 ml flask. It was stirred for 1.5 hr at room temperature. The reaction was monitored by HPLC until the consumption of starting product was observed and 96% of iodinated product was detected. The solution was then acidified to pH=1.0 with a 5% solution of HCl and extracted with ethyl acetate. The organic phases were combined and washed with a solution of sodium thiosulphate and then dried over anhydrous magnesium sulphate. The solvent was removed at low pressure and a crude of 98% purity was obtained and then purified by chromatography on silica gel. 260 mg (86% yield) of the desired product was obtained.
